AI Summary
5 min readRecent earnings from Amazon, Meta, Microsoft, and Google revealed surging AI-driven profits, prompting upward revisions to their 2026 capital expenditures from $630 billion to $800 billion, with $1.1 trillion projected for the following year. These hyperscalers, alongside revenue from OpenAI and Anthropic, are funneling cash into AI infrastructure, driving massive gains in related stocks: SanDisk up 40x, Micron 7-8x, Intel and AMD around 4x over the past year. The episode maps this "trillion-dollar waterfall" down the AI stack, explaining how money flows from top-tier revenue to foundational components, helping listeners orient investments amid FOMO and bubble concerns.
Earnings Shift Validates AI Spending
Q1 2026 reports from the four hyperscalers showed AI investments not only boosting revenue and profits but also justifying accelerated CapEx, all funded from cash flows without leverage. This counters bubble fears, as Brad Gerstner noted on CNBC: unlike past hype, AI use cases like those from Anthropic and OpenAI generate billions in annual recurring revenue weekly. Google reclaimed the world's most valuable company spot, powering a flywheel where utility drives payments, sustaining spend as long as AI unlocks value. NVIDIA, once dominant, now sits second at $4 trillion market cap, with money propagating outward.
